Depression
A mental health disorder characterized by persistent feelings of sadness, loss, or anger that interfere with daily activities.
Delusions
False beliefs held with strong conviction despite superior evidence to the contrary, often seen in psychiatric conditions.
Anhedonia
The inability to feel pleasure in normally pleasurable activities, often associated with depression and other mental health disorders.
Hallucinations
Awareness of phenomena during alertness and wakefulness, without external input, that resemble the characteristics of genuine perception.
